Vous êtes sur la page 1sur 2

MPSI 2022-2023

Informatique

Résumé

S. GLOBEZ 1
MPSI 2022-2023

Définition Un dictionnaire est alors un ensemble de couples clé : valeur


dico = {}
tel =
{'Valentin':'0658951423','Cathy':'0751210783','Theo':'01
69842154'}
Création tel['Romain']='0836656565'
Ajout Eleve = {}
Eleve['nom'] = 'Pierre'
Eleve['classe'] = 'MPSI'
Eleve['notes info'] = [17,12,10]
Eleve['age'] = 19

Clé de type tuple ou


réels
Nombre d’éléments len(dico)
Résupération de
dico['age']
valeurs
for cle in dico: for cle in dico:
print(cle) print(dico[cle])
for cle in dico.keys(): for val in dico.values():
Parcours print(cle) print(val)
for cle, val in dico.items():
print(cle,val)
Existence d’une clé cle in dico
Suppression d’un del dico[cle]
couple
Comptage
L =
L =
[1,2,1,3,5,7,9,1,4,5,3,6,5,
[1,2,1,3,5,7,9,1,4,5,3,6,5,
2,8,7,3,6,4,9,2,1,5,3,5,8,4
2,8,7,3,6,4,9,2,1,5,3,5,8,4
,4,5,3,0,1,8,0]
,4,5,3,0,1,8,0]
dico = {}
dico = {}
for elem in L:
for i in range(10):
if elem in dico:
dico[i] = 0
dico[elem] += 1
for elem in L:
else:
dico[elem] += 1
dico[elem] = 1
print(dico)
print(dico)

Applications Chemin
dico = {'paris':'lyon','bordeaux':'saint
etienne','lyon':'marseille','brest':'rouen','bastia':'li
lle','nice':'brest','vienne':'valence','paris':'lyon','r
ouen':'bordeaux','montpelier':'bastia','valence':'montpe
lier','lyon':'marseille','saint
etienne':'vienne','marseille':'nice','lille':'strasbourg
'}

Depart = 'paris'
Arrivee = 'strasbourg'
Intermediaire = Depart
while Intermediaire != Arrivee:
Intermediaire = dico[Intermediaire]
print(Intermediaire)

S. GLOBEZ 2

Vous aimerez peut-être aussi